The Willows, a quiet hamlet in East Hertfordshire, draws its character from the gentle sweep of the surrounding countryside. It lies 7.0 km west-north-west of Stansted Mountfitchet (from Stansted Mountfitchet: bearing 297°T, OS grid TL 446 280), and is situated east-north-east of Barleycroft End village.
